php將textarea數(shù)據(jù)提交到mysql出現(xiàn)很多空格的解決方法
本文實例講述了php將textarea數(shù)據(jù)提交到mysql出現(xiàn)很多空格的解決方法。分享給大家供大家參考。具體分析如下:
有一些朋友可能會發(fā)現(xiàn)我們在html提交給php處理保存數(shù)據(jù)到mysql中之后會發(fā)現(xiàn)我們再次從mysql讀出數(shù)據(jù)時會有很多的空格了,那么我們如果直接在mysql中查看又沒有空間,這是什么問題要如何處理呢.
textarea中總是有很多空格問題解決
問題描述:
在php讀取mysql數(shù)據(jù)到textarea中開頭可結尾總有很多空格,在數(shù)據(jù)表中查看數(shù)據(jù)是沒有空格的.
問題原因:
內容應該頂著textarea寫,textarea后不要有空格和換行.
解決方法:
代碼如下:
echo str_replace(' ', '', 'ab ab');
//輸出 "abab'
?>
或者使用
echo strtr('ab ab', array(' '=>''));
// 輸出 "abab"
?>
補充:
php textarea中的換行符為"\r\n"
不是'\n'
不是"<br />"
不是'\r\n'
不是'\r'+'\n'
希望本文所述對大家的PHP程序設計有所幫助。
相關文章
EarthLiveSharp中cloudinary的CDN圖片緩存自動清理python腳本
這篇文章主要介紹了EarthLiveSharp暫時沒有清理cloudinary的CDN圖片緩存的功能,于是我用python寫了一個,并嘗試用gist管理,需要的朋友可以參考下2017-04-04ThinkPHP自動轉義存儲富文本編輯器內容導致讀取出錯的解決方法
這篇文章主要介紹了ThinkPHP自動轉義存儲富文本編輯器內容導致讀取出錯的解決方法,需要的朋友可以參考下2014-08-08